| My banana tree has a nice bunch of green bananas that I am afraid won't ripen before we get a freeze.
Any suggestions? A couple of years ago we tried putting some in a bag with store bought over ripe ones, ours turned yellow but did not ripen on the inside. We got a bunch a few weeks ago that did ripen on the tree, they were really good. |

| Bring the whole bunch in on the stalk before a hard frost or freeze. We hung our stalk on the hall tree and when they ripened, made banana pudding! Note: Even in the hot climates where bananas are grown commercially, they don't let the fruit ripen on the trees. |
